Understanding tire markings is essential before selecting chevrolet camaro tires for your vehicle. Each sidewall displays a standardized code that reveals everything about fitment and performance capabilities. A typical Camaro tire reads P245/45R20 99W, and each element tells a specific story.
The opening letter indicates tire classification. P-metric tires begin with "P" and follow Tire and Rim Association standards for passenger vehicles. Euro-metric sizes skip the prefix letter and follow European Tire and Rim Technical Organization standards. LT designates light truck applications that require higher inflation pressures.
The three-digit number shows tire width in millimeters from sidewall to sidewall. After the slash, you'll find a two-digit aspect ratio expressed as a percentage of width. The letter R confirms radial construction. The final two digits specify rim diameter in inches. Load index and speed rating follow these dimensions, indicating maximum weight capacity and sustained speed limits.
Tire width directly affects your Camaro's contact patch and handling characteristics. A 245mm tire measures exactly 245 millimeters at its widest point. Aspect ratio determines sidewall height as a percentage of width. With a 45 aspect ratio, sidewall height equals 45 percent of the tire's width. For our 245mm example: 245mm × 0.45 = 110.25mm sidewall height.
Calculating overall tire diameter requires adding both sidewalls to rim diameter. Convert sidewall measurements to inches first: 110.25mm ÷ 25.4 = 4.34 inches per sidewall. Double that figure (8.68 inches) and add the 20-inch rim for 28.68 inches total diameter.
Performance Camaros employ staggered setups with wider rear tires for improved traction and handling. The 2016 camaro ss tire size features 245/40R20 fronts and 275/35R20 rears. When choosing camaro tires and rims with different widths, keep rolling diameter differences within 1-2% to maintain accurate speedometer readings. Proper tire-to-wheel width ratios range from 1 to 1.4 inches wider than wheel width. A 9-inch wheel works with 245mm to 255mm tires, while 10-inch wheels accommodate 275mm to 285mm rubber.
Factory specifications appear in three locations: the tire sidewall, driver's door jamb placard, and owner's manual. These references guarantee replacement tires meet original load ratings and speed capabilities for safe vehicle operation.
Understanding factory tire specifications helps you select compatible aftermarket options. Each Camaro generation features distinct sizing patterns that affect your upgrade choices.
Fourth-generation Camaros used a 5x120.65mm bolt pattern. Base models from 1993 through 2001 ran 215/60R16 or 235/55R16 tires. Z28 variants stepped up to 235/55R16 or 245/50R16 sizing. The SS models introduced in 1996 featured significantly wider 275/40R17 tires.
Factory sizing evolved throughout this generation. Base models standardized on 235/55R16 by 2002, Z28s maintained 245/50R16, and SS models kept their distinctive 275/40R17 configuration.
Fifth-generation models adopted a 5x120mm bolt pattern. LS and LT trims offered multiple configurations: 245/55R18, 245/50R19, or staggered 245/40R21 front with 275/35R21 rear setups. SS models featured staggered arrangements with 245/45R20 fronts and 275/40R20 rears.
Stock suspension SS fitment typically used 20x10 +35 fronts with 275/40R20 and 20x11 +35 rears with 315/35R20 tires. The ZL1 introduced in 2012 featured 285/35R20 fronts and 305/35R20 rears. Performance variants escalated sizing significantly. The SS 1LE received 285/35R20 sizing by 2014, while the Z/28 ran extreme 305/30R19 tires.
Sixth-generation SS models standardized on staggered 245/40R20 front and 275/35R20 rear configurations starting in 2016. Standard 2016 2SS models came with 20-inch black five-spoke wheels in staggered widths. Wheel sizes typically ranged from 18 to 20 inches in diameter with widths between 8.5 and 11 inches.
Performance packages feature significantly wider configurations. The SS 1LE Track Package runs 285/30R20 fronts and 305/30R20 rears. Standard ZL1 models share this 285/30R20 and 305/30R20 staggered setup. The ZL1 1LE Extreme Track Package features the widest factory configuration at 305/30R19 front and 325/30R19 rear.

Measure from the mounting hub to inner fender wall using a plumb bob to establish maximum tire width. Maintain at least 1 inch clearance around all interference points including A-arms, shocks, and tie rod ends. Account for suspension travel through full compression and rebound cycles.
Understanding wheel well limitations prevents costly fitment mistakes. Check clearance at multiple steering positions and suspension heights. Full lock steering often reveals interference issues that straight-ahead measurements miss.
Camaro bolt patterns are expressed as two numbers: lug count and spacing distance. Fifth and sixth-generation models use 5x120mm patterns. Offset changes affect track width. Stay within 15-20mm of factory offset to avoid handling issues and component wear. Higher positive offset brings wheels closer to suspension and brakes, potentially limiting clearance.
Wrong offset creates serious problems beyond just appearance. Excessive positive offset can cause brake caliper interference, while negative offset stresses wheel bearings and creates unpredictable handling characteristics.
Tire diameter changes create false speed readings. Keep overall diameter within 5% of original equipment. A 3% taller tire shows 60 mph when actual speed reaches 63.3 mph. Speedometers calculate speed based on wheel rotations calibrated to original tire circumference.
Speedometer accuracy affects more than just speed awareness. Insurance companies and law enforcement rely on accurate readings, making proper diameter matching essential for legal protection.
Allow 3mm minimum clearance between calipers and wheels in all directions. Larger brake kits require checking clearance templates before purchase. Wheel diameter alone doesn't guarantee clearance. Spoke depth and barrel design affect brake fitment correspondingly.
Test fitment with cardboard templates before ordering wheels. Many wheels that appear compatible on paper create interference with Brembo brake packages or aftermarket big brake kits.
Staggered configurations prevent tire rotation, reducing tire life. Most manufacturers cut mileage warranties by up to 50% on staggered applications. Keep front and rear rolling diameter differences within 1-2% for speedometer accuracy and drivetrain health.
While staggered setups enhance handling performance, they increase replacement costs and limit tire rotation options. Consider these trade-offs when deciding between square and staggered configurations for your Camaro.

Camaro tire sizes vary depending on the model and generation. Stock sizes range from 245/50R18 on base models to 275/35R20 on performance variants. The 2016 Camaro SS typically uses a staggered setup with 245/40R20 front and 275/35R20 rear tires, while ZL1 models run even wider configurations like 285/30R20 front and 305/30R20 rear.
To verify wheel fitment, measure the offset (distance from the wheel's center to the mounting surface) and add it to half the wheel's width for backspace, or subtract it for front space. Compare these measurements to your wheel well dimensions. For Camaros, stay within 15-20mm of factory offset and maintain at least 1 inch of clearance around all interference points including suspension components and brake calipers.
The 3% rule refers to keeping your new tire's overall diameter within 3% of the original size to maintain speedometer accuracy. When you exceed this threshold, your speedometer will display incorrect readings. For example, a tire that's 3% taller will show 60 mph when you're actually traveling at 63.3 mph, which can lead to speeding tickets and drivetrain issues.
